summary:
  #1753718: clarify RFC compliance and bytes/string argument types.

Patch includes contributions by Isobel Hooper, incorporating suggestions from
Paul Winkler.  Reviewed by Martin Panter.

In addition to accepting the corrections for the RFC compliance wording, I
went through and corrected all the argument and return types, and made the
pattern of how the arguments and return types are documented consistent.
So, this patch also addresses #20782, though I had forgotten about that issue
and its patch.

+There are two interfaces provided by this module.  The modern interface
+supports encoding :term:`bytes-like objects <bytes-like object>` to ASCII
+:class:`bytes`, and decoding :term:`bytes-like objects <bytes-like object>` or
+strings containing ASCII to :class:`bytes`.  All three :rfc:`3548` defined
+alphabets (normal, URL-safe, and filesystem-safe) are supported.
+
+The legacy interface does not support decoding from strings, but it does
+provide functions for encoding and decoding to and from :term:`file objects
+<file object>`.  It only supports the Base64 standard alphabet, and it adds
+newlines every 76 characters as per :rfc:`2045`.  Note that if you are looking
+for :rfc:`2045` support you probably want to be looking at the :mod:`email`
+package instead.
